Shared public. Kitties usually stay close by. Knock on neighbors doors and check neighbors yards...bushes, under sheds, etc. Be sure to look up...inside bushes...up in trees. My son's kitty was missing for a week. It was up a tree one block over. Go out later after dark when things quiet down and call for your kitty. My kitty was missing for 5 days so don't give up. He was hiding 4 houses down under a gazebo. They tend to come out later at night. Go outside and open a can of cat food...tap the can with a s to make feeding time noises and call for him/her. If you leave food or litter outside bring in by 10 pm to avoid the attention of other wildlife. Post Lost Flyers (large) around your neighborhood and check every day with local animal shelters/animal control. If your kitty isn't chipped, please consider doing that. Sending lots of positive energy your way that you find your precious fur baby.

Immediately put out her dirty litter box anything that smells of her food or of you including your dirty clothing your dirty sneakers cats can smell up to 1 mile away and that is how she will find her way home they usually come out between Dusk and Dawn and stay within a five house radius of their own home for at least the first week or so
